news 2026/4/23 14:11:20

1小时打造你的Wappalyzer克隆版

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
1小时打造你的Wappalyzer克隆版

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个最小可行(MVP)的技术分析工具原型,核心功能只需实现:URL输入、基础技术识别(框架、CMS)、简单结果展示。使用预训练模型加速开发,界面只需包含必要元素。重点展示快速实现过程,代码应简洁可扩展,方便后续迭代。提供一键部署到InsCode的功能。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在研究如何快速验证产品想法,发现用现代开发工具配合AI辅助,1小时就能做出一个基础版的技术分析工具原型。今天就来分享一下我的Wappalyzer克隆版开发过程,特别适合想快速验证创意的开发者。

  1. 明确核心功能既然是MVP版本,我只聚焦三个最基础的功能点:URL输入框、技术识别引擎、结果展示区。这样既能验证核心逻辑,又不会陷入过度开发的陷阱。

  2. 技术选型前端用React搭建简单界面,后端选择Node.js处理请求。为了加速开发,直接调用现成的技术指纹库,省去了自己收集特征的工作量。

  3. 界面开发用Create React App快速初始化项目,只保留必要的组件:

  4. 一个带提交按钮的输入框
  5. 加载状态提示
  6. 结果展示卡片
  7. 错误提示区域

  8. 后端逻辑创建简单的Express服务,主要处理:

  9. 接收前端传来的URL
  10. 获取网页HTML内容
  11. 分析页面特征匹配已知技术
  12. 返回识别结果

  13. 技术识别实现这里用了取巧的方法:

  14. 预存常见框架的识别特征(如React的data-reactroot属性)
  15. 检查特定脚本链接(如jquery.js)
  16. 匹配meta标签中的CMS标识

  17. 部署上线在InsCode(快马)平台上,直接把代码仓库导入后,点击部署按钮就完成了上线。整个过程不到2分钟,不用操心服务器配置。

  1. 优化建议虽然基础版已经能用,但还可以:
  2. 增加更多技术指纹
  3. 实现批量检测
  4. 添加可视化图表
  5. 支持导出报告

整个开发过程最深的体会是:现代工具链让原型开发变得异常高效。特别是像InsCode(快马)平台这样的服务,省去了部署环节的麻烦,可以专注在核心功能的实现上。从零开始到可演示的线上版本,实际编码时间不到1小时,这对快速验证产品想法特别有帮助。

如果你也想尝试快速开发原型,不妨试试这个思路。记住MVP的核心是"最小可行",先做出能用的版本,再根据反馈迭代完善。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个最小可行(MVP)的技术分析工具原型,核心功能只需实现:URL输入、基础技术识别(框架、CMS)、简单结果展示。使用预训练模型加速开发,界面只需包含必要元素。重点展示快速实现过程,代码应简洁可扩展,方便后续迭代。提供一键部署到InsCode的功能。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 12:11:57

LangChain官方手册中文版实战:构建智能问答系统

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 使用LangChain官方手册中文版作为知识库,构建一个智能问答系统。系统应能接受用户自然语言问题,如LangChain如何处理长文本,并从手册中提取准确…

作者头像 李华
网站建设 2026/4/23 14:44:35

Sambert-HifiGan语音合成服务隐私保护措施

Sambert-HifiGan语音合成服务隐私保护措施 引言:中文多情感语音合成的隐私挑战 随着深度学习技术的发展,端到端语音合成(TTS)系统在智能客服、有声阅读、虚拟主播等场景中广泛应用。基于ModelScope平台的 Sambert-HifiGan 中文多情…

作者头像 李华
网站建设 2026/4/23 11:26:08

CRNN模型解释性:识别结果的可信度

CRNN模型解释性:识别结果的可信度 📖 项目简介 在现代信息处理系统中,OCR(光学字符识别)技术已成为连接物理世界与数字世界的桥梁。无论是扫描文档、提取发票信息,还是智能交通中的车牌识别,OCR…

作者头像 李华
网站建设 2026/4/23 13:02:38

3分钟验证:Ubuntu NVIDIA驱动快速测试环境搭建

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个使用Docker快速搭建Ubuntu NVIDIA驱动测试环境的方案,包含:1.基础Ubuntu镜像 2.NVIDIA容器工具包配置 3.驱动版本切换功能 4.简单CUDA测试程序 5.环…

作者头像 李华
网站建设 2026/4/22 21:46:16

Java 线程安全及不可变性

我们可以通过创建不可变的共享对象来保证对象在线程间共享时不会被修改,从而实现线程安全。如下示例: public class ImmutableValue{ private int value = 0; public ImmutableValue(int value){ this.value = value; } public int getValue(){ return this.value; }…

作者头像 李华
网站建设 2026/4/23 14:42:11

Sambert-HifiGan在公共服务领域的应用案例

Sambert-HifiGan在公共服务领域的应用案例 📌 引言:让服务更有“温度”的语音合成技术 随着人工智能技术的不断演进,公共服务领域正经历从“数字化”向“智能化”的深刻转型。传统的自动化语音系统(如电话客服、广播提示&#xff…

作者头像 李华